Output 107ecaadaa6c3ce7a359f2cdcd92cf2c1e56e50da98d75da79861f582de5d99a:1

value
41346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887fadc9cb1fd17c38f6cae5dfb1a86404532cb0 OP_EQUAL
address
3E8kmv3mkh7ZuXTDpcBMcoyXrJPYRCQ4P7
transaction
107ecaadaa6c3ce7a359f2cdcd92cf2c1e56e50da98d75da79861f582de5d99a
confirmations
94649
spent
true